Using Sabermetrics for Fantasy Baseball: Ballpark Factors

If you have ever selected a streamable pitcher based on home park or benched an otherwise must-start arm at Coors Field, you already know how much a stadium can impact a player's bottom line. Nick Ahmed's Absence Tuesday Not Related To Knee Injury

Arizona Diamondbacks shortstop Nick Ahmed was removed from the lineup Tuesday due to personal issues, according to Steve Gilbert of MLB.com. Ahmed had missed time recently due to right knee soreness, and he was scheduled to make his return to the lineup Tuesday before his sudden removal. Wander Franco Reassigned To Minor League Camp

Tampa Bay Rays shortstop Wander Franco was reassigned to minor league camp on Monday, according to Adam Berry of MLB.com. The move was not surprising, as Franco was considered a long-shot to crack the roster after missing last year due to the canceled minor league season, as well as having never played above High-A. Wander Franco Plays Third Base

Tampa Bay Rays infield prospect Wander Franco, traditionally a shortstop, played third base on Sunday. The Rays coaching staff values versatility among its players and the move provides the 20-year-old with a smoother path to big-league playing time.
